Job Purpose:
The School of Human Ecology at Tennessee Tech University invites candidates to apply for a full‑time twelve‑month, non‑tenure track Clinical Track faculty position in Child Life to begin July 1, 2026.
Essential Functions
The successful candidate will be expected to teach Child Life courses and other courses as needed, assist with mentoring and retention of students, and supervise experiential learning experiences leading to a Master of Science degree in Child Life.
Minimum Qualifications
- PhD or terminal degree from an accredited institution at the time of appointment in Human Development/Sciences or Family Studies/Sciences or a closely related field
- Credentialing as a Certified Child Life Specialist by the Child Life Certification Commission
- Minimum of five years of professional experience as a Certified Child Life Specialist post credentialing
- Oral and written communication skills at a level appropriate to convey information to and from students, colleagues and others in a clear manner
Preferred Qualifications
- Minimum of seven years of professional experience as a Certified Child Life Specialist post credentialing
- Evidence of at least two years of college‑level teaching experience as primary instructor online or in‑person
- Experience with supervising child‑life internship students as a clinical preceptor
- Evidence of experience with advising and mentoring students
- Knowledge of curriculum design and experience with various teaching methods, including online delivery and assessment of learning
- Active membership in the Association of Child Life Professionals with expectation to join the Child Life Academic Society once employed
- Demonstrated ability to work collaboratively in both university and community settings with faculty, staff, students, and community stakeholders
Compensation And Benefits
Salary commensurate with education and experience. Full‑time twelve‑month, non‑tenure track position to begin July 1, 2026. The University offers a competitive benefits package: two vacation days per month, one sick leave day per month, thirteen University holidays, medical and life insurance (shared cost with the university), retirement, optional 401(k), and educational benefits.
